A 37-aa standard natural multi-activity (Antibacterial, Anticancer, Antifungal, and other sources) peptide sequence curated from AntiBP3, dbAMP, DRAMP, and other sources, with an available 3D structural model.
Sequence
GGYYCPFRQDKCHRHCRSFGRKAGYCGGFLKKTCICV

% Hemolysis
Hemolysis
2.0 64.6 %
[Ref.21504572] It has 2.0% and 64.6% hemolysis at concentrations of 12.5 µM and 100 µM against human erythrocytes .

Target

human erythrocytes

Source & Reference

Hemolytik APD_complete PD_Hemolysis
DRAMP4
Parasit Vectors. 2011 Apr 19 4(1):63.
